WebBurgers' equation is a scalar conservation law with flux f ( q) = q 2 / 2 : (1) q t + ( 1 2 q 2) x = 0. The quasilinear form is obtained by applying the chain rule to the flux term: q t + q q x = 0. This equation looks very similar to the advection equation, with the difference that the advection speed at each point is given by the solution q. WebMay 26, 2024 · The non-linear Burgers' equation is discretized in the spatial direction by using second order Finite difference method which converts the Burgers' equation to non-linear system of ODEs. Then, the backward differentiation formula of order two (BDF-2) is employed to march the solution in the time direction.
WebMar 6, 2024 · Burgers vortex layer or Burgers vortex sheet is a strained shear layer, which is a two-dimensional analogue of Burgers vortex. This is also an exact solution of the Navier-Stokes equations, first described by A. A. Townsend in 1951.
